What is the cheapest Jeddah to Morocco flight route?

The cheapest ticket to Morocco from Jeddah found in the last 5 days was to Casablanca, at 1,906 ﷼ round-trip. The most popular route is from Jeddah (JED) to Casablanca (CMN), and the cheapest round-trip airline ticket found on this route in the last 5 days was 1,906 ﷼.

What is the cheapest time of day to fly to Morocco?

The cheapest time of day to fly to Morocco is generally in the evening, when round-trip flights cost 2,586 ﷼ on average. Morning departures are around 21% more expensive than evening flights, on average. The most expensive time of day to fly to Morocco is generally in the morning, which is peak travel time and where the average cost of a ticket is 3,137 ﷼.

Can I save money by flying with a layover from Jeddah to Morocco?

Yes, flying with a layover may cost you more time, but you can also save money on the route, with a 1 stop layover the cheapest option at 2,031 ﷼ on average.

What is the cheapest month to fly from Jeddah to Morocco?

The cheapest month for flights from Jeddah to Morocco is May, when tickets cost 2,349 ﷼ (return) on average. On the other hand, the most expensive months are March and August, when the average cost of round-trip tickets is 3,614 ﷼ and 3,218 ﷼ respectively.

What’s the cheapest day of the week to fly from Jeddah to Morocco?

If your flying dates are flexible, you should consider flying to Morocco on a Wednesday, as we generally find the cheapest rates on that day for this route. On the other hand, Saturday is the most expensive day to fly from Jeddah to Morocco. For your return ticket, we recommend flying on a Tuesday and avoiding Sundays for the best deals.

How far in advance should I book a flight from Jeddah to Morocco?

To get a below average price on the flight from Jeddah to Morocco, you should book around 6 weeks before departure, which saves you about 14% compared to booking last minute. For the absolute cheapest price, our data suggests you should book 15 weeks before departure.
